CPU Role

The AMD Ryzen 7 5700X3D brings 8 cores and 16 threads based on the Zen 3 architecture (codename Vermeer), manufactured on TSMC's 7 nm process. Its base clock is 3.00 GHz with a boost clock of 4.10 GHz. The CPU's defining feature for gaming is the 96 MB shared L3 cache — a massive pool that helps with data reuse in game workloads. This is reflected in the benchmark data: the 3DMark 16-thread score of 6,764 and max-thread score of 6,755 show strong multi-threaded scaling, while the single-thread score of 804 indicates capable per-core performance.

In Lockdown Protocol, an FPS title, the CPU's role is to feed the GPU with draw calls and game logic updates. The data suggests the 5700X3D handles this well. At 1080p Low, the combo reaches 233 FPS — a frame rate that is likely CPU-limited at the top end, given that the GPU is not under heavy load at this resolution and preset. The 3DMark 2-thread score of 1,575 and 4-thread score of 3,097 indicate that the CPU's single-thread and lightly-threaded performance is sufficient to sustain high frame rates in scenarios where GPU load is low.

The CPU's cache configuration is particularly relevant. With 96 MB of shared L3 cache, the 5700X3D can store large portions of game data on-die, reducing memory latency. The DDR4 memory support with dual-channel configuration and 51.2 GB/s bandwidth is not the fastest available, but the large cache compensates. The Cinebench R23 multi-core score of 22,366 and single-core score of 3,157 confirm the CPU's balanced capabilities. For Lockdown Protocol, the data indicates the CPU is not a limiting factor until frame rates exceed approximately 233 FPS, which only happens at 1080p Low.

GPU Role

The NVIDIA GeForce RTX 4080 is the dominant component in this combo, and the data shows it drives performance at all tested settings. The GPU features 16 GB of GDDR6X memory on a 256-bit bus with 716.8 GB/s bandwidth. Its 9,728 shading units, 304 texture mapping units, and 112 ROPs deliver substantial raw throughput: 48.74 TFLOPS FP32 and 761.5 GTexel/s texture rate. The base clock is 2,205 MHz with a boost clock of 2,505 MHz, and memory runs at 1,400 MHz (22.4 Gbps effective).

The GPU's benchmark results place it firmly in high-end territory. The 3DMark Steel Nomad DX12 score of 6,567 and Geekbench Vulkan score of 263,779 indicate strong DirectX 12 and Vulkan performance — both relevant for modern FPS titles. The Passmark G3D score of 34,457 and GPU compute score of 20,671 further confirm the card's capabilities. The RTX 4080 sits at the 86th percentile among all GPUs, and its nearest rivals are all within 2.7% of its average score.

In Lockdown Protocol, the GPU's VRAM capacity of 16 GB provides ample headroom for high-resolution textures and effects. At 4K Ultra, the combo produces 73 FPS — the lowest measured result, still above the 60 FPS playability threshold. At 4K High, it rises to 98 FPS, and at 4K Medium, 112 FPS. The scaling from 4K Low (157 FPS) to 4K Ultra (73 FPS) shows a 53% performance drop, indicating that the GPU is the primary bottleneck at this resolution. The RTX 4080's GDDR6X memory bandwidth of 716.8 GB/s is sufficient to avoid memory bandwidth limitations, as evidenced by the smooth scaling between presets.

Resolution Scaling

The measured FPS data reveals clear resolution scaling patterns. At High settings, the combo produces 196 FPS at 1080p, 151 FPS at 1440p, and 98 FPS at 4K. This represents a 23% drop from 1080p to 1440p, and a 50% drop from 1080p to 4K. At Low settings, the numbers are 233 FPS (1080p), 210 FPS (1440p), and 157 FPS (4K) — a 10% drop from 1080p to 1440p and a 33% drop from 1080p to 4K.

The scaling pattern indicates that the GPU is the primary limiting component at higher resolutions, particularly at 4K. The drop from 1080p Low to 4K Low is 76 FPS (33%), while the drop from 1080p High to 4K High is 98 FPS (50%). This larger percentage drop at High settings suggests that the GPU's shading and memory bandwidth resources are more heavily taxed at higher quality presets. The RTX 4080's 716.8 GB/s bandwidth and 48.74 TFLOPS FP32 performance are sufficient to maintain high frame rates, but the load increases disproportionately with resolution.

At 1080p, the combo is likely CPU-limited at Low settings (233 FPS) but becomes GPU-limited at higher presets. The relatively small drop from 1080p Low to 1440p Low (233 to 210 FPS, a 10% reduction) indicates that the CPU can still feed the GPU adequately at 1440p. However, the larger drop from 1440p Low to 4K Low (210 to 157 FPS, a 25% reduction) shows the GPU becoming the bottleneck. At Medium settings, the frame rates are 205 FPS (1080p), 173 FPS (1440p), and 112 FPS (4K) — a pattern consistent with GPU-bound scaling.

The 4K Ultra result of 73 FPS is the notable outlier, representing a 53% drop from 4K Low. This large performance penalty at Ultra settings suggests that the game's Ultra preset includes effects that heavily tax the GPU — likely advanced lighting, shadows, or post-processing. The RTX 4080's 112 ROPs and 280.6 GPixel/s pixel rate handle the resolution increase, but the Ultra preset's additional computational demands reduce the frame rate below the 100 FPS threshold that this combo achieves at 4K High.
